| // SPDX-License-Identifier: GPL-2.0 |
| |
| #include <linux/bpf.h> |
| #include <bpf/bpf_helpers.h> |
| #include "bpf_misc.h" |
| |
| #if (defined(__TARGET_ARCH_arm64) || defined(__TARGET_ARCH_x86) || \ |
| (defined(__TARGET_ARCH_riscv) && __riscv_xlen == 64)) && __clang_major__ >= 18 |
| |
| SEC("socket") |
| __description("LDSX, S8") |
| __success __success_unpriv __retval(-2) |
| __naked void ldsx_s8(void) |
| { |
| asm volatile (" \ |
| r1 = 0x3fe; \ |
| *(u64 *)(r10 - 8) = r1; \ |
| r0 = *(s8 *)(r10 - 8); \ |
| exit; \ |
| " ::: __clobber_all); |
| } |
| |
| SEC("socket") |
| __description("LDSX, S16") |
| __success __success_unpriv __retval(-2) |
| __naked void ldsx_s16(void) |
| { |
| asm volatile (" \ |
| r1 = 0x3fffe; \ |
| *(u64 *)(r10 - 8) = r1; \ |
| r0 = *(s16 *)(r10 - 8); \ |
| exit; \ |
| " ::: __clobber_all); |
| } |
| |
| SEC("socket") |
| __description("LDSX, S32") |
| __success __success_unpriv __retval(-1) |
| __naked void ldsx_s32(void) |
| { |
| asm volatile (" \ |
| r1 = 0xfffffffe; \ |
| *(u64 *)(r10 - 8) = r1; \ |
| r0 = *(s32 *)(r10 - 8); \ |
| r0 >>= 1; \ |
| exit; \ |
| " ::: __clobber_all); |
| } |
| |
| SEC("socket") |
| __description("LDSX, S8 range checking, privileged") |
| __log_level(2) __success __retval(1) |
| __msg("R1_w=scalar(smin=-128,smax=127)") |
| __naked void ldsx_s8_range_priv(void) |
| { |
| asm volatile (" \ |
| call %[bpf_get_prandom_u32]; \ |
| *(u64 *)(r10 - 8) = r0; \ |
| r1 = *(s8 *)(r10 - 8); \ |
| /* r1 with s8 range */ \ |
| if r1 s> 0x7f goto l0_%=; \ |
| if r1 s< -0x80 goto l0_%=; \ |
| r0 = 1; \ |
| l1_%=: \ |
| exit; \ |
| l0_%=: \ |
| r0 = 2; \ |
| goto l1_%=; \ |
| " : |
| : __imm(bpf_get_prandom_u32) |
| : __clobber_all); |
| } |
| |
| SEC("socket") |
| __description("LDSX, S16 range checking") |
| __success __success_unpriv __retval(1) |
| __naked void ldsx_s16_range(void) |
| { |
| asm volatile (" \ |
| call %[bpf_get_prandom_u32]; \ |
| *(u64 *)(r10 - 8) = r0; \ |
| r1 = *(s16 *)(r10 - 8); \ |
| /* r1 with s16 range */ \ |
| if r1 s> 0x7fff goto l0_%=; \ |
| if r1 s< -0x8000 goto l0_%=; \ |
| r0 = 1; \ |
| l1_%=: \ |
| exit; \ |
| l0_%=: \ |
| r0 = 2; \ |
| goto l1_%=; \ |
| " : |
| : __imm(bpf_get_prandom_u32) |
| : __clobber_all); |
| } |
| |
| SEC("socket") |
| __description("LDSX, S32 range checking") |
| __success __success_unpriv __retval(1) |
| __naked void ldsx_s32_range(void) |
| { |
| asm volatile (" \ |
| call %[bpf_get_prandom_u32]; \ |
| *(u64 *)(r10 - 8) = r0; \ |
| r1 = *(s32 *)(r10 - 8); \ |
| /* r1 with s16 range */ \ |
| if r1 s> 0x7fffFFFF goto l0_%=; \ |
| if r1 s< -0x80000000 goto l0_%=; \ |
| r0 = 1; \ |
| l1_%=: \ |
| exit; \ |
| l0_%=: \ |
| r0 = 2; \ |
| goto l1_%=; \ |
| " : |
| : __imm(bpf_get_prandom_u32) |
| : __clobber_all); |
| } |
| |
| #else |
| |
| SEC("socket") |
| __description("cpuv4 is not supported by compiler or jit, use a dummy test") |
| __success |
| int dummy_test(void) |
| { |
| return 0; |
| } |
| |
| #endif |
| |
| char _license[] SEC("license") = "GPL"; |
